logo

深度优化指南:掌握DeepSeek技巧,释放模型性能潜力

作者:问题终结者2025.09.25 22:22浏览量:0

简介:本文从参数调优、硬件加速、数据优化等角度系统解析DeepSeek模型优化策略,提供可落地的性能提升方案,助力开发者突破模型效率瓶颈。

一、参数调优:精准配置模型行为

1.1 核心超参数优化策略

模型性能对超参数高度敏感,需通过系统化调参实现最佳平衡。学习率作为梯度更新的关键参数,建议采用动态调整策略:初始阶段设置0.001-0.01的较高值加速收敛,中期降至0.0001-0.0005避免震荡,末期使用0.00001-0.00005微调。例如在文本生成任务中,动态学习率使模型收敛速度提升40%,损失函数波动减少65%。

批处理大小(batch size)需根据硬件资源动态配置。NVIDIA A100 GPU环境下,推荐采用256-512的批处理量,配合梯度累积技术实现等效大批量训练。测试显示,批处理量从64增至256时,吞吐量提升3.2倍,但超过512后因内存带宽限制出现性能衰减。

1.2 架构参数深度优化

注意力机制配置直接影响模型上下文理解能力。在长文本处理场景中,建议将注意力窗口扩展至2048-4096,配合滑动窗口注意力(Sliding Window Attention)技术,使内存占用降低58%的同时保持92%的上下文捕捉精度。

层数与隐藏维度的组合优化需遵循”金字塔原则”:底层采用1024-2048维宽层快速捕捉基础特征,中层保持768-1024维平衡计算与表达,顶层缩减至512-768维聚焦核心语义。实验表明,这种配置使模型在GLUE基准测试中的平均得分提升7.3%。

二、硬件加速:释放计算潜能

2.1 GPU资源极致利用

混合精度训练(FP16/BF16)可将显存占用降低40%,配合Tensor Core加速使计算吞吐量提升2.8倍。实际应用中需注意数值稳定性,建议对梯度裁剪阈值设置为1.0,损失缩放因子动态调整在128-8192区间。

模型并行策略选择需考虑通信开销。当参数规模超过10B时,推荐采用张量并行(Tensor Parallelism)分割矩阵运算,配合流水线并行(Pipeline Parallelism)处理不同层。在8卡A100集群上,这种混合并行使ResNet-152训练时间从23小时缩短至4.7小时。

2.2 内存管理优化技术

激活检查点(Activation Checkpointing)技术通过重计算前向传播激活值,可将显存占用从O(n)降至O(√n)。在BERT-large训练中,该技术使单卡可处理序列长度从512增至2048,同时增加18%的计算开销。

零冗余优化器(ZeRO)技术通过参数分片消除冗余存储,配合CPU卸载策略可将模型并行度提升至1024卡规模。测试显示,ZeRO-3模式使175B参数模型的训练效率达到91.2%的理论峰值。

三、数据工程:构建高效训练集

3.1 数据预处理优化

动态数据采样策略可根据模型当前状态调整数据分布。初期采用均匀采样快速建立基础能力,中期转向困难样本挖掘(Hard Negative Mining),后期实施课程学习(Curriculum Learning)渐进增加任务难度。在SQuAD 2.0数据集上,该策略使EM分数提升9.6%。

数据增强技术需针对任务特性定制。文本分类任务可采用同义词替换(Synonym Replacement)、随机插入(Random Insertion)等方法,生成增强数据与原始数据的比例建议控制在1:3至1:5。实验表明,适度增强可使模型在低资源场景下的F1值提升12.8%。

3.2 数据质量管控体系

建立三级数据过滤机制:基础层使用规则过滤去除重复、乱码样本;中间层实施语义一致性检测,剔除上下文矛盾数据;顶层采用模型预过滤,移除低置信度样本。在医疗文本数据中,该体系使噪声数据比例从23%降至1.7%。

数据版本管理需记录每个批次的统计特征,包括词频分布、标签平衡度、序列长度等。建议维护数据指纹(Data Fingerprint)系统,通过MD5哈希追踪数据演变,确保实验可复现性。

四、推理优化:提升部署效率

4.1 模型压缩技术

知识蒸馏(Knowledge Distillation)通过教师-学生架构实现模型轻量化。选择与学生模型容量匹配的教师(如BERT-base指导ALBERT-tiny),配合中间层特征对齐,可使小模型在GLUE任务上达到教师模型93%的性能,参数量减少92%。

量化感知训练(Quantization-Aware Training)通过模拟低精度运算调整权重分布。在INT8量化场景中,建议采用逐层校准策略,对注意力权重保留FP32精度,其他层实施对称量化。测试显示,该方法使推理速度提升4.2倍,精度损失控制在1.5%以内。

4.2 动态推理策略

自适应计算(Adaptive Computation)根据输入复杂度动态调整计算量。在图像分类任务中,对简单样本提前退出(Early Exiting),使平均推理时间减少37%,同时保持98.2%的准确率。该技术特别适用于实时性要求高的边缘计算场景。

缓存机制优化可显著提升重复查询效率。建立K-V缓存存储历史注意力结果,配合局部敏感哈希(LSH)实现近似最近邻搜索。在对话系统中,该技术使上下文响应时间从120ms降至23ms,缓存命中率达到89%。

五、监控体系:持续性能优化

建立多维监控仪表盘,实时追踪训练损失、梯度范数、参数更新量等20+核心指标。设置动态阈值告警,当连续3个批次出现梯度消失(范数<0.001)或爆炸(范数>100)时自动触发恢复机制。

实施A/B测试框架对比不同优化策略的效果。建议采用多臂老虎机(Multi-Armed Bandit)算法动态分配流量,在保证系统稳定性的前提下快速验证优化方案。实际应用中,该框架使优化周期从周级缩短至天级。

通过系统化的优化策略,开发者可显著提升DeepSeek模型的训练效率和推理性能。参数调优需结合任务特性进行精细化配置,硬件加速要充分利用现代计算架构特性,数据工程应构建端到端的质量管控体系,推理优化要注重动态调整能力,监控体系则保障优化过程的可控性。这些技术组合应用可使模型吞吐量提升5-8倍,延迟降低60-80%,为实际业务场景提供强有力的技术支撑。

相关文章推荐

发表评论

活动